Job description

Family Farm and Home is a family owned and operated company based out of Michigan. Our first stores opened their doors in April 2002. Currently we operate 71 retail locations in Michigan, Indiana, Ohio, Maryland and Pennsylvania . We cater to our customers' needs by supplying a wide variety of products in departments such as tools, hardware, automotive, pet, work and casual clothing, footwear, farm supplies, horse and livestock feed, bird food, lawn and garden, and alternative heating.
Here at Family Farm and Home, our outstanding team members are dedicated to providing incredible product values and exceptional customer service to all customers. Because of this commitment, Family Farm and Home has experienced rapid growth on all levels. Our continued growth in the future is limitless due to our devoted staff and constantly growing group of loyal customers. Are YOU ready to join the FFH Family?
A seasonal associate must provide outstanding customer service and accurate information to customers in regards to merchandise carried within Family Farm and Home. They will assist with product merchandising, register assistance as well as support the store management team as needed. The seasonal associate is a temporary position, with varying hours, effective from February 1st to July 31st with an opportunity for permanent employment based on performance and given availability.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ities, Include but are not limited to:
• Promote Family Farm and Home mission statement and family values.
• Maintain awareness of all promotions and advertisements
• Uphold merchandising, store cleanliness, and safety standards
• Contribute to the daily maintenance of the store
• Participate in the recovery, execution and proper labeling of products
• Complete register training, understand all forms of payment related operations, and assist with the register as needed
• Follow all Family Farm and Home and OSHA guidelines for a safe work environment.
• Conscious of shoplifting activity.
• Aid customers in locating merchandise in store and on the Family Farm and Home website as well as loading merchandise into vehicles
• Supports Family Farm and Home selling initiatives, i.e. loyalty program, private label credit card, item of the month and protection plans
• Assist in fulfillment and loadout of BOPIS (Buy Online Pick Up In Store) orders
• Assist in the completion of store closing duties
• Contributes to a positive working environment for all team members
• All other duties as assigned by store management or company official
Seasonal Associate Requirements:
A Family Farm and Home seasonal associate must be able to work a flexible schedule including weekends, evenings, and holidays. Associates need to have basic product knowledge along with a willingness to learn. Excellent verbal and written communication skills with the ability to communicate clearly and effectively in all situations are necessary as a seasonal associate. They will also need to demonstrate a commitment to excellent service and customer satisfaction. A successful seasonal associate will be a strong team player yet still be able to work independently with minimal supervision. They must contribute to a positive working environment for all team members. Seasonal associates need to have knowledge of basic computer systems. They must be able to stand for extended periods of time as well as be able to climb up and down ladders, reach, bend, twist, kneel, and lift up to 50lbs.
